Some background of Kimware.Kimware started appearing in Hong Kong in 2002.The first batch lasted till 2003.What you see now is the first batch.

There are a few different types of flushing system.What you see here is the cistern with the pulling handle.

The most common type of Kimware flushing system in Hong Kong is by pushing a button.This will be shown in the next post.Of course,the cistern flushing system sounds the best.

Kimware is very common in Hong Kong.It can be found in 80% of the public toilets.If you are looking for the type shown here(flushing with cistern),you can find it in the few locations below...
